One Egg Muffins II

Simple and quick muffins, perfect for breakfast or a snack. This recipe is modernized with the addition of fruit, inspired by the 'Cereal with Fruit' recipe.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ups All-purpose flour
  • 4 teaspoons Ba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 2 tablespoons Granulated sugar
  • 1 cup Milk
  • 2 tablespoons Melted butter
  • 1 Egg
  • 0.5 cup Fresh fruit (berries, chopped apple, banana) (Inspired by 'Cereal with Fruit' recipe)

Instructions

  1. 1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ease or line a 6-cup muffin tin.
  2. 2In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, salt, and sugar.
  3. 3In a separate bowl, whisk together the milk, melted butter, and egg.
  4. 4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ined. Do not overmix.
  5. 5Gently fold in the fresh fruit.
  6. 6Fill each muffin cup about 2/3 full.
  7. 7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. 8Let the muffins cool in the tin for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
